    Our rafting trip was canceled due to low water levels on the Shotover River, so Plan B: bike ride. One thing about Queenstown: there is no shortage of things to do here.
    So we got a map from the bike supplier, worked out what we thought w/b a good route of the many paths available, and hit the road. Our plan involved connecting a few paths to get to what's supposed to be a highly recommended lakeside path.
    That was the plan.
    Using the supplied paper map we succeeded in taking about 10 wrong turns that unexpectedly lead us through a beautiful golf community, large farms and some sheep fields. Switching to google maps we eventually made our way to/around the lake and took the shorter route home due to the extra miles we spent 'exploring' the area. We were e very thankful to have rented EV bikes as there were a number of hills that would have made the ride difficult, but the EV power settings worked nicely. We returned to the store ~4:15pm & rewarded our efforts with some ice cream. 🍨😋
